Output 6a82c97bc27c7cfe255b14181274dfcd1db19f2aa71f532dd1a7024efdfa9428:1

value
43876800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f277a0e664fb0c9bbe28930bccfbd8bab03f380 OP_EQUAL
address
38uYbbN27sNVgr9dLDfVxqrGuYCkT4i1A7
transaction
6a82c97bc27c7cfe255b14181274dfcd1db19f2aa71f532dd1a7024efdfa9428
confirmations
262018
spent
true